10cf71bb9847001a1063a7e2d9392769
来自「Java examples for dinamic programming, d」· 代码 · 共 41 行
TXT
41 行
package practicas;
import problemas.Busqueda;
import soluciones.practi04.BusquedaBinaria;
import soluciones.practi04.BusquedaLineal;
import temporizadores.Temporizador;
public class Practi04 {
/**
* @param args
*/
public static void main(String[] args) {
int [] n = { 10,1000, 100000,10000000 };
Temporizador t = new Temporizador(5);
Busqueda problema;
BusquedaBinaria bb;
BusquedaLineal bl;
int casoBusqueda = Busqueda.EXITO_PRINCIPIO;
for (int i = 0; i < n.length; i++) {
problema = new Busqueda(n[i], casoBusqueda);
System.out.println(problema);
bl = new BusquedaLineal (problema);
t.cronometra(bl);
System.out.println(bl);
System.out.println(t);
bb = new BusquedaBinaria (problema);
t.cronometra(bb);
System.out.println(bb);
System.out.println(t);
}
}
}
⌨️ 快捷键说明
复制代码Ctrl + C
搜索代码Ctrl + F
全屏模式F11
增大字号Ctrl + =
减小字号Ctrl + -
显示快捷键?